N. Hinrichs is a scholar working on Automotive Engineering, Control and Systems Engineering and Mechanics of Materials. According to data from OpenAlex, N. Hinrichs has authored 12 papers receiving a total of 498 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Automotive Engineering, 5 papers in Control and Systems Engineering and 5 papers in Mechanics of Materials. Recurrent topics in N. Hinrichs's work include Brake Systems and Friction Analysis (6 papers), Dynamics and Control of Mechanical Systems (5 papers) and Adhesion, Friction, and Surface Interactions (5 papers). N. Hinrichs is often cited by papers focused on Brake Systems and Friction Analysis (6 papers), Dynamics and Control of Mechanical Systems (5 papers) and Adhesion, Friction, and Surface Interactions (5 papers). N. Hinrichs collaborates with scholars based in Germany, Switzerland and Norway. N. Hinrichs's co-authors include M. Oestreich, Karl Popp, Erich Barke, Chris Budd, Marc Stierand, Vlad Petre Glăveanu and Felipe A. Csaszar and has published in prestigious journals such as Strategic Management Journal, Journal of Sound and Vibration and Organizational Behavior and Human Decision Processes.
